BAKU, March 30. /TASS/. Russia seeks to further foster relations with Azerbaijan, Russian Ambassador to Azerbaijan Mikhail Bocharnikov said at the press conference on Wednesday.
"The signing of the Declaration on Allied Cooperation between Russia and Azerbaijan brings relations between the countries to a new steady level," the ambassador said.
According to Bocharnikov, Baku and Moscow have an interest in peace and security in the region. "Russia aims to further develop allied relations, friendship and good-neighborliness," he noted.
The Declaration on Allied Cooperation was signed by Russian President Vladimir Putin and Azerbaijani leader Ilham Aliyev on February 22 following the talks in the Kremlin. As Putin noted, the document is dedicated to the 30th anniversary of establishing diplomatic relations.
